### Account Recovery — Catalogue Import (Lintwood)

Quick one for review: when the Lintwood catalogue import wipes a patron's session table, the recovery flow re-seeds accounts from the nightly snapshot. Check that the importer skips locked accounts — last time it didn't. To rerun recovery against staging you'll need the vault passphrase, which is appended just below.

recovery phrase for yafof-tajof: julmir-kelax-julvan-holath-belvan-holir-ralael-ralvan-ralath-julvan-silmir-istmir-kaswyn-ulamir

## Further Reading

The Quillcheck documentation linter enforces heading order, link validity, and terminology from the shared glossary. Maintainers extending its rule set should first review the rule-authoring conventions and the test fixtures under `rules/spec`. The full architecture overview and style rationale are maintained on the internal page linked below.

dashboard of bafof-hafog = https://confluence.lumiclabs.internal/display/browse/display/6a09a20a

Runbook fragment — Replica Lag Alarm (Quorra Data Platform)

The alarm fires when the read replica for the Ledgerline cluster trails the primary by more than 45 seconds for three consecutive checks. Typical causes are long-running analytical queries or vacuum backlog. Responders should verify replication slots, check for blocking transactions, and confirm no failover is in progress. All access during investigation is logged for audit. The full procedure and review checklist live on this internal page:

runbook for tafof-yawif: https://confluence.tolvaqsys.internal/display/display/browse/pages/7be3

The garage occupancy feed for the Brindlewood campus arrives over a message queue every thirty seconds, one record per level, published by the Stallgrid edge boxes. Counts can briefly go negative when a sensor double-fires on exit; the ingest job clamps these to zero and flags the interval. If the feed stalls for more than five minutes, the dashboard falls back to the last known snapshot. Sensor mappings, queue names, and the replay procedure are documented on the internal page below.

runbook for tahog-kadug: https://gitlab.qirvanworks.corp/projects/pages/view/b139298aed28